#099964 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#099964 is composed of 3.5% red, 60%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 34.6%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 157.9 degrees, a saturation of 88.9% and a lightness of 31.8%. #099964 color hex could be obtained by blending #12ffc8 with #003300. Closest websafe color is: #009966.

Shades and Tints of #099964
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000503 is the darkest color, while #f1fef9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#099964
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4e5452 is the less saturated color, while #039f66 is the most saturated one.
